Church roof replacement services involve removing the existing roofing material on a church or similar large property and installing a new, durable roof in its place. This process typically includes thorough inspection of the underlying structure, removal of old shingles or roofing materials, repairs to any damaged decking, and the installation of new roofing components designed to withstand weather and time. Professional contractors ensure that the new roof is properly sealed and secured, helping to protect the building’s interior and preserve its structural integrity for many years to come.
These services are especially valuable when a roof has become compromised due to age, weather damage, or accumulated wear and tear. Common problems prompting replacement include leaks, missing or curling shingles, extensive moss or algae growth, or sagging sections that indicate underlying structural issues. Replacing a worn or damaged roof not only prevents further deterioration but also helps avoid costly repairs to the building’s interior or structural elements caused by water infiltration or rot.

The overview below groups typical Church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hastings,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or roof repairs, such as replacing a few shingles or fixing leaks,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Partial Roof Replacement - When replacing a section of a roof, local contractors often charge between $1,500 and $4,000. Projects of this size are common and can vary based on roof size, materials, and complexity.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ete roof replacements for average-sized homes usually cost between $5,000 and $12,000. Larger or more complex projects can reach $15,000+, though these are less frequent.
High-End or Complex Projects - Extensive or intricate roof replacements, including premium materials or multiple layers, can exceed $20,000. Such projects are less common but necessary for larger or more customized roofing systems.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
